Jamaicans battened down as Beryl churned toward the Island as a Category 5 storm.
Hurricane Beryl, a dangerous Category 5 storm, has caused devastation in the Caribbean, leaving one person dead and wreaking havoc in Jamaica. The storm set a record as the earliest Category 5 hurricane, with forecasts predicting more destruction and potential flooding in Hispaniola.
